怎么把angularjs转换成app
在如今移动应用开发的蓬勃发展中,许多开发者希望将他们在Web开发中熟悉的框架和技术应用到移动应用开发中。其中,将AngularJS转换为移动应用是一个常见的需求。下面将详细介绍如何实现这一转换过程。
首先,我们需要了解AngularJS适用于Web开发的特点和功能,然后理解移动应用开发的常用工具和框架。接着,我们可以开始转换的准备工作。
1. 准备工作
在将AngularJS转换为移动应用之前,我们需要确保已经安装好所需的工具和环境,包括Node.js、Ionic框架和Cordova插件等。这些工具将帮助我们构建和打包移动应用,并提供与设备交互的能力。
2. 重构代码
将AngularJS应用程序转换为移动应用的第一步是重构代码。由于移动应用的界面和用户交互方式与Web应用有所不同,我们需要重新设计和优化界面,以适应移动设备的屏幕大小和触摸操作。
在重构代码时,需要注意以下几点:
- 使用Ionic提供的组件和样式来构建移动应用的界面,例如导航栏、标签页和侧边菜单等。
- 优化性能,减少网络请求和数据传输量,以提高应用的加载速度和响应时间。
- 考虑移动应用的离线功能,使用本地存储或缓存技术来处理数据的离线访问。
3. 构建移动应用
完成代码的重构后,我们可以使用Ionic提供的命令行工具来构建和打包移动应用。通过运行一系列命令,我们可以选择目标平台(如iOS或Android)并生成对应的应用程序文件。
4. 测试和调试
一旦移动应用构建完成,我们需要进行测试和调试以确保应用的稳定性和正常功能。我们可以使用模拟器或真实设备来测试应用在不同环境下的表现,并通过调试工具来查找和修复潜在的问题。
5. 发布和推广
最后,我们可以将已经转换为移动应用的AngularJS应用程序发布到应用商店或其他平台上,供用户下载和使用。同时,我们也可以通过推广渠道来宣传和推广我们的移动应用,吸引更多用户使用和反馈。
通过以上步骤,我们可以将原本用于Web开发的AngularJS转换为适用于移动应用的版本,并享受到移动平台带来的便利和用户体验。但需要注意的是,在转换过程中可能会遇到一些挑战和难题,需要耐心和技术支持来解决。
总结起来,将AngularJS转换为移动应用需要进行代码重构、构建应用、测试调试和发布推广等步骤。这个过程涉及到不同的工具和技术,但通过深入理解和充分准备,我们可以成功完成这个转换,并创建出功能强大的移动应用。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。